Section 20 (5) states that the Minister "shall arrange for a report laid before both Houses of the Oireachtas in accordance with subsection (1)to be published in such form and manner as he or she thinks appropriate as soon as practicable after copies of the report are so laid". It is a purely technical amendment that corrects a mistake in the text of the Bill. This is a proposal simply to delete subsection (1) and replace it with a reference to subsection (4). This was always the intention of the Minister, but it was incorrectly drafted in the version that was actually circulated.
